Ecosystem Integration: The Core Advantage of iPhone
The most compelling reason to switch to iPhone in 2025 is ecosystem cohesion. If you own—or plan to own—an iPad, Mac, Apple Watch, or AirPods, the iPhone becomes the central hub that unlocks seamless functionality across devices.
Features like Universal Clipboard, Handoff, Instant Hotspot, and iCloud Keychain work effortlessly when all your devices run Apple’s operating systems. For example, copying text on your iPhone and pasting it directly into a document on your MacBook requires zero setup. Similarly, answering calls or texts from your iPad while your iPhone is in another room is instantaneous.
Android offers some cross-device features through Samsung Flow, Google’s Quick Pair, or Nearby Share, but they remain fragmented. They work best within single brands (e.g., Samsung phones with Galaxy Buds) and rarely match Apple’s consistency across hardware and software layers.
“Apple’s vertical integration gives them an edge no Android OEM can replicate. When everything is built in-house, synchronization becomes invisible.” — David Lin, Mobile Systems Analyst at TechInsight Group
Privacy and Security: A Defining Shift
In 2025, privacy remains a key differentiator. Apple has positioned itself as a privacy-first company, embedding protections directly into iOS. Features like App Tracking Transparency, Mail Privacy Protection, and on-device processing for Siri requests mean your data stays on your phone unless you explicitly allow otherwise.
Google, while improving with Android 15’s permission auto-reset and approximate location sharing, still relies heavily on data collection for personalization and ad targeting. Even if anonymized, the architecture assumes data flows back to Google services.
iOS also receives five years of guaranteed OS updates—a policy now matching many flagship Android devices—but Apple’s centralized control ensures faster, more uniform rollouts. In contrast, Android updates depend on manufacturers and carriers, often delaying critical security patches by months.
If you value long-term device support and minimal data leakage, iPhone wins. But if you’re comfortable managing permissions manually and prefer transparency over enforced restrictions, Android still offers more granular control.
Performance and Longevity: What You Can Expect
iPhone users consistently report longer usable lifespans. An iPhone 13 from 2021 runs iOS 18 smoothly in 2025, benefiting from Apple’s tight hardware-software optimization. Most flagship Android phones perform well for three to four years, but mid-tier models often degrade faster due to less aggressive memory management and background app throttling.
Benchmarks show Apple’s A-series chips outperform even the latest Snapdragon 8 Gen 3 in sustained workloads. This doesn’t always translate to real-world speed differences, but it does mean better future-proofing for demanding apps like video editing, AR, and AI-powered tools.
| Factor | iPhone (2025) | Flagship Android (2025) |
|---|---|---|
| OS Update Guarantee | 5–6 years | 4–5 years (varies by brand) |
| Chip Performance (Sustained) | Excellent | Very Good |
| Battery Health Management | Optimized charging, % display | Limited; varies by OEM |
| Resale Value After 2 Years | ~60–70% | ~40–50% |
However, iPhones lack expandable storage and rely solely on iCloud for backups—costly beyond the free 5GB tier. Android devices with microSD slots (rare but still available) or USB-C file transfer offer more flexibility for media-heavy users.
What You Lose: Customization, Flexibility, and Control
Switching to iPhone means accepting constraints Apple imposes on design, functionality, and personalization. Android excels in flexibility:
- You can change default apps freely—browser, messaging, launcher, voice assistant.
- Widgets are interactive and customizable in size and placement.
- File system access allows direct manipulation of folders and media.
- Third-party app stores and sideloading are permitted without jailbreaking.
iOS 18 introduces improved widgets and limited default app changes, but still restricts deep customization. Launchers? Not allowed. System-wide dark mode scheduling? Only via automation shortcuts. File management remains confined to the Files app, which lacks the intuitive folder navigation found on Android.
Power users accustomed to automation tools like Tasker may find Shortcuts limiting, despite Apple’s improvements. While Shortcuts supports complex workflows, it operates within stricter sandboxing rules and fewer triggers.

Step-by-Step Guide to Switching Smoothly in 2025
Making the leap requires planning. Follow this timeline to minimize friction:
- Week 1: Audit Your Data
Identify what needs transferring—contacts, messages, photos, calendars, notes, passwords, and app data. Use Google Takeout to download backups. - Week 2: Prepare Your iPhone
Set up two-factor authentication for Apple ID. Subscribe to iCloud+ if you need more than 5GB. Install essential apps like Gmail, Google Drive, and WhatsApp beforehand. - Day of Switch: Use Apple’s Move to iOS App
On your Android, download “Move to iOS” from the Play Store. During iPhone setup, select “Transfer Data from Android” and follow prompts. This moves contacts, message history, photos, videos, and Google accounts. - First 3 Days: Rebuild Key Workflows
Migrate email accounts, set up calendar sync, restore password manager (1Password or Bitwarden), and configure automation shortcuts. - First Month: Optimize Settings
Fine-tune notification settings, enable Focus modes, set up Family Sharing if applicable, and explore native apps like Notes and Reminders.
Note: iMessage cannot import SMS threads older than what fits in temporary transfer space. Back up messages externally if needed.

Frequently Asked Questions
Can I keep using Google apps on iPhone?
Yes. Gmail, Google Maps, YouTube, Google Drive, and Chrome are fully available on iPhone. However, they won’t integrate as deeply with the OS—for example, Chrome can’t be the default browser in the sense of capturing all web links system-wide without manual redirection.
Will my Android smartwatch work with iPhone?
Most Android wearables, including Wear OS watches from Samsung or Fossil, do not pair with iPhones. You’ll need to switch to an Apple Watch for full functionality. Limited notifications may work via Bluetooth, but core features like health syncing and app support will be unavailable.
Is switching back to Android difficult?
Yes, returning to Android from iPhone is harder. iMessage deactivation can cause delays in receiving SMS from other iPhone users (they appear as undelivered). Google provides no official tool equivalent to Move to iOS for reverse migration, so data must be exported manually via iCloud or third-party services.
